# Copyright 2023 bill-auger # SPDX-License-Identifier: CC0-1.0 # Maintainer: bill-auger pkgname=talksoup _upstream_name=TalkSoup pkgrel=1 pkgver=1.1 pkgdesc="IRC client for GNUstep" arch=(armv7h i686 x86_64) url=http://gap.nongnu.org/talksoup/index.html license=(GPL2) depends=(gnustep-netclasses) makedepends=(gcc-objc gnustep-make) source=(http://savannah.nongnu.org/download/gap/${_upstream_name}-${pkgver}.tar.gz) sha256sums=(3a469c66ce3067a88603d6ebae6f63fbcfad55586dd5455179887f28e5a63ae7) build() { cd ${_upstream_name}-${pkgver} export GNUSTEP_MAKEFILES=$(gnustep-config --variable=GNUSTEP_MAKEFILES) make } package() { cd ${_upstream_name}-${pkgver} make DESTDIR="${pkgdir}" install cd "${pkgdir}"/usr/lib/GNUstep/Applications/${_upstream_name}.app/Resources/ # install.desktop file to the standard system location install -d "${pkgdir}"/usr/share/applications sed -i 's|^Categories=X-GNUstep;|&Network;Chat;IRCClient;|' ${_upstream_name}.desktop mv ${_upstream_name}.desktop "${pkgdir}"/usr/share/applications/${pkgname}.desktop }